"Places of Silence: Journeys of Freedom" by Eugenia C. Delamotte offers a captivating exploration of freedom and self-discovery. Through a collection of personal narratives, the author takes readers on a journey to various locations where silence becomes a pathway to liberation. Delamotte's writing is both poetic and thought-provoking, prompting readers to reflect on the importance of finding inner stillness in a chaotic world.

Each chapter of the book explores different locales, ranging from serene natural landscapes to bustling urban environments. Delamotte expertly weaves together stories from her own experiences and those she encounters, painting a vibrant picture of the transformative power of silence. Throughout the book, she emphasizes that silence is not merely the absence of noise, but rather a space for introspection and connection with ourselves and others.

Delamotte excels at evoking a sense of place through her writing. Whether describing the tranquility of a forest or the liveliness of a city street, she immerses readers in each setting with vivid descriptions. As readers journey from one location to another, they gain a deeper understanding of how cultural contexts can shape our relationship with silence and freedom.
